Pro Tips for Your 2025 Playlist
- BPM Variety: Mix 100-110 BPM tracks for beginners with 125+ BPM power songs
- Cultural Rotation: Alternate between reggaeton, cumbia, and amapiano to work different muscle groups
- AI Assist: Use streaming apps' "BPM Match" features to create seamless transitions
- Vocal Cues: Look for songs with clear rhythmic cues ("Hey!" "Dale!") for class coordination
